에듀 메이커 보드
에듀 메이커 보드는 교육용으로 개발된 마이크로 컨트롤러 기반의 개발 보드이다. 주로 피지컬 컴퓨팅, 코딩 교육, 메이커 교육 등 다양한 분야에서 활용된다. 아두이노(Arduino)와 유사한 인터페이스를 제공하여 사용자가 쉽게 프로그래밍하고, 센서, 액추에이터, 디스플레이 등 다양한 외부 장치를 연결하여 상호작용하는 프로젝트를 구현할 수 있도록 설계되었다.
주요 특징
- 사용 편의성: 초보자도 쉽게 접근할 수 있도록 직관적인 개발 환경과 풍부한 교육 자료를 제공한다.
- 다양한 연결 옵션: 다양한 센서 및 액추에이터 연결을 위한 입출력 포트(GPIO), 아날로그 입력, PWM 출력, 통신 인터페이스(UART, I2C, SPI) 등을 지원한다.
- 확장성: 외부 모듈 및 확장 보드를 연결하여 기능을 확장할 수 있다.
- 프로그래밍 언어: 일반적으로 아두이노 IDE를 사용하여 C/C++ 기반으로 프로그래밍하거나, 스크래치(Scratch), 블록클리(Blockly) 등 블록 기반의 비주얼 프로그래밍 언어를 지원하여 코딩 경험이 없는 사용자도 쉽게 프로그래밍할 수 있도록 한다.
- 교육 자료: 에듀 메이커 보드와 관련된 다양한 교육 자료, 예제 코드, 프로젝트 아이디어가 온라인으로 제공되어 학습을 돕는다.
활용 분야
- 피지컬 컴퓨팅: 센서를 이용하여 주변 환경을 감지하고, 액추에이터를 통해 물리적인 반응을 일으키는 시스템 개발
- 로봇 공학: 간단한 로봇 제어, 자율 주행 자동차 제작 등
- 사물 인터넷(IoT): 센서 데이터를 수집하고 네트워크를 통해 전송하는 IoT 장치 개발
- 자동화 시스템: 가정 자동화, 스마트 농업 등 자동화 시스템 개발
- 예술 및 디자인: 인터랙티브 아트, 웨어러블 디바이스 제작 등
관련 용어
- 마이크로 컨트롤러
- 피지컬 컴퓨팅
- 아두이노(Arduino)
- 스크래치(Scratch)
- 블록클리(Blockly)
- 센서
- 액추에이터
- GPIO (General Purpose Input/Output)
- UART (Universal Asynchronous Receiver/Transmitter)
- I2C (Inter-Integrated Circuit)
- SPI (Serial Peripheral Interface)